Output 60592b1a94922fea252fa7d01e44089ca2669bde5f8527cd551025c781e608c6:6

value
189288859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cc6d9b4efac66f94840f4c4e005dc30dd50cc88 OP_EQUAL
address
35mmsMTPxgotsLJNWbQ9u6g29fEXTV1hTW
transaction
60592b1a94922fea252fa7d01e44089ca2669bde5f8527cd551025c781e608c6
confirmations
282428
spent
true